廣告管理系統-數據庫表設計


廣告管理系統

各個平台焦點圖的管理

根據不同平台 不同位置 表設計

CREATE TABLE `focus` (
`id` int(11) unsigned NOT NULL AUTO_INCREMENT,
`type` tinyint(2) unsigned DEFAULT '0' COMMENT '類型:PC,H5,APP',
`place` tinyint(2) DEFAULT NULL COMMENT '位置:首頁,左側,右側,列表頁',
`url` varchar(100) CHARACTER SET latin1 DEFAULT '' COMMENT '鏈接地址',
`img_src` varchar(150) DEFAULT NULL COMMENT '封面圖片',
`alt` char(50) CHARACTER SET latin1 DEFAULT '' COMMENT '簡述',
`remark` varchar(150) CHARACTER SET latin1 DEFAULT '' COMMENT '備注信息',
`sort` tinyint(1) DEFAULT NULL COMMENT '排序',
`create_time` int(11) DEFAULT NULL COMMENT '創建時間',
`update_time` int(11) DEFAULT NULL COMMENT '修改時間',
`operator_id` int(11) DEFAULT NULL COMMENT '操作人ID',
`status` tinyint(1) DEFAULT NULL COMMENT '狀態 1 正常 2 禁用',
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 COMMENT='焦點圖管理表';

 

圖片管理系統

CREATE TABLE `zl_file` (
`id` int(10) unsigned NOT NULL AUTO_INCREMENT,
`cate` tinyint(3) unsigned NOT NULL DEFAULT '1' COMMENT '文件類型,1-image | 2-file',
`name` varchar(255) NOT NULL DEFAULT '' COMMENT '文件名',
`original` varchar(255) NOT NULL DEFAULT '' COMMENT '原文件名',
`domain` varchar(255) NOT NULL DEFAULT '' COMMENT '訪問域名',
`type` varchar(255) NOT NULL DEFAULT '' COMMENT '文件類型',
`size` int(10) unsigned NOT NULL DEFAULT '0' COMMENT '文件大小',
`mtime` int(10) unsigned NOT NULL DEFAULT '0' COMMENT '創建時間',
PRIMARY KEY (`id`) USING BTREE
) ENGINE=InnoDB A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;

 

注意:做廣告系統就是為了好管理廣告或者說是焦點圖,這樣不用改動代碼,只需運營自己改動即可。省人工省時。

同時還要注意代碼的可復用行。封裝方法,簡化代碼,清楚MVC每個層都代表什么?怎么使用?


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M